Project off the coast of New Jersey, United States
The Long-term Ecological Observatory (LEO) is a project off the coast of
New Jersey, United States, which monitors the processes in the ocean with online
IT systems, spearheaded by the Institute of Marine and Coastal Sciences at
Rutgers University. Already installed are sensors for temperature,
salinity,
transmission, light, light
attenuation,
fluorescence, pressure and velocity.
